Commit History

Autor SHA1 Mensaxe Data
  Andreas Kling ac85fdeb1c Kernel: Handle ProcessGroup allocation failures better %!s(int64=3) %!d(string=hai) anos
  Andreas Kling 55adace359 Kernel: Rename SpinLock => Spinlock %!s(int64=3) %!d(string=hai) anos
  Andreas Kling ed6f84c2c9 Kernel: Rename SpinLockProtectedValue<T> => SpinLockProtected<T> %!s(int64=3) %!d(string=hai) anos
  Andreas Kling c94c15d45c Everywhere: Replace AK::Singleton => Singleton %!s(int64=4) %!d(string=hai) anos
  Andreas Kling d6667e4cb8 Kernel: Port process groups to SpinLockProtectedValue %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ro 425195e93f Kernel: Standardize the header include style to 'include <Kernel/...>' %!s(int64=4) %!d(string=hai) anos
  Daniel Bertalan f820917a76 Everywhere: Use nothrow new with `adopt_{ref,own}_if_nonnull` %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ro 7e691f96e1 Kernel: Switch ProcessGroup to IntrusiveList from InlineLinkedList %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ro 3d7cc471d6 Revert "Kernel: Avoid allocating under spinlock in ProcessGroup::find_or_create" %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ro 124a523199 Revert "Kernel: Fix regression, removing a ProcessGroup that not in the list" %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ro bbe315d8c0 Kernel: Fix regression, removing a ProcessGroup that not in the list %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ro e95eb7a51d Kernel: Avoid allocating under spinlock in ProcessGroup::find_or_create %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ro bb91bed576 Kernel: Make ProcessGroup::find_or_create API OOM safe %!s(int64=4) %!d(string=hai) anos
  Andreas Kling b91c49364d AK: Rename adopt() to adopt_ref() %!s(int64=4) %!d(string=hai) anos
  Brian Gianforcaro 1682f0b760 Everything: Move to SPDX license identifiers in all files. %!s(int64=4) %!d(string=hai) anos
  Tom 046d6855f5 Kernel: Move block condition evaluation out of the Scheduler %!s(int64=4) %!d(string=hai) anos
  AnotherTest 688e54eac7 Kernel: Distinguish between new and old process groups with equal pgids %!s(int64=5) %!d(string=hai) anos